摘要:随着测试技术的不断数字化、智能化和计算机化,振动传感器成为振动测试中的关键因素,一般可选择加速度来测量振动。本文以某一型号的测振仪为被测对象,选用比较法中频振动标准装置,在一定的环境条件下,对参考频率和参考加速度下的示值进行测量,并对振动传感器加速度的示值误差测量结果的不确定度进行分析和评定。
关键词:振动传感器;加速度;示值误差;测量不确定度

Evaluation of measurement uncertainty of vibration acceleration sensor
ZHONG Meifang
(Jiangxi Insititute of Measurement and Testing,Nanchang 330002,China)
Abstract: Along with test technology development, digitization and intellectualization, vibration sensor becomes the key factor in the vibration test. Acceleration test often is used in vibration test. Taking middle-range frequency standard equipment for comparison as example, this article discussed measurement of acceleration and evaluation of measurement uncertainty in the test.
Key words: Vibration sensor;Acceleration;Indication error;Uncertainty of measurement
